I suppose you've been wondering what the heck "The Vault" is exactly (those of you who have seen it). Well ZBCode, I'd be glad to let you in on this little secret. The Vault is a joinable group we have created for the members to participate in something special. Members and staff will be directly communicating ideas, comments, suggestions and anything to offer to the community. Isn't that the same thing as the feedback forum? Good question. The thing about the feedback forums is that members tend to hold back for whatever reason(s). In this forum, members will have the chance to post literally every and any idea they have, any comment, anything they feel contributing toward the board. Plenty of ideas shared in "The Vault" will be the future of ZBCode. So that's where you ask yourself, do you want to take part in that? Do you want your contributions becoming a part of ZBC?
